What is Ozempic?
Ozempic is a prescription medication used to manage blood sugar levels in adults with type 2 diabetes. It belongs to a class of drugs understood as GLP-1 receptor agonists, which assist stimulate insulin production, reduce cravings, and sluggish gastric emptying. The primary goal of Ozempic is to improve glycemic control, and it might also help in weight reduction for some patients.

Ozempic is normally recommended for adults with type 2 diabetes who have not accomplished enough blood glucose control with way of life modifications or other medications. It is important to speak with a doctor to figure out if Ozempic Fast Delivery is a proper choice based upon private health needs.
2. How often do I need to take Ozempic?
Ozempic is administered as a subcutaneous injection once a week. Patients should follow their health care company's directions for dosing and administration.
3. Can Ozempic aid with weight loss?
While Ozempic is primarily used to handle blood glucose levels, it may also assist in weight reduction for some clients. However, it is not particularly approved for weight reduction, so discussing this potential benefit with a doctor is essential.
4. Are there any adverse effects?
Common side impacts of Ozempic consist of n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and abdominal pain. Clients must report any extreme or consistent negative effects to their health care service provider.
5. Exist any special storage requirements for Ozempic?
Cheap Ozempic need to be kept in the fridge before usage. When in use, it can be kept at room temperature level for approximately 56 days. Always examine the maker's guidelines for specific storage guidelines.
